Blenheim Underwriting Limited (BUL) is a Lloyd’s managing agent that is authorised by the Prudential Regulation Authority and regulated by the Financial Conduct Authority and the Prudential Regulation Authority. Blenheim Underwriting is responsible for the management of Syndicate 5886 at Lloyd’s.
Syndicate 5886 began writing in January 2017 and comprises a mix of direct and reinsurance business both open market and via delegated authorities, including via our MGA trading platform Blenheim Partnerships, where considered appropriate.
Blenheim Underwriting trades in areas where we believe our experience adds value to the Lloyd’s market and is capable of sustainable profit without taking undue risk. We are receptive to looking at future opportunities presented by proven teams with their own franchise that fit the ethos of the business.

John has over thirty years’ experience within the Lloyd’s market and co-founded the White Bear Capital Group in 2016. John is Chief Executive Officer of Blenheim Underwriting Limited and a director of Blenheim Partnerships Limited. John was one of the founders and Chief Financial Officer of Cathedral Underwriting Limited from start up in 2000 to sale to Lancashire Insurance PLC in 2013, remaining as CFO of Cathedral until 2016.

Peter has worked in the Lloyd’s marketplace for over thirty years and co-founded the White Bear Capital Group in 2016. Peter is Chief Executive Officer of Blenheim Partnerships Limited and a Director of Blenheim Underwriting Limited. In 2000 Peter was appointed CEO and one of the founders of Cathedral Capital Limited from start up to the sale to Lancashire Holdings Limited in 2013, remaining as CEO of Cathedral within the Lancashire Group until 2016. Prior to joining Cathedral, Peter had 14 years of Insurance Industry experience including being appointed to Managing Director of Wren Lloyd’s Advisors in 1995, working on establishing the first generation of Lloyd’s Corporate Capital Vehicles. Peter holds a BSC (Econ) in Economics and Geography from University College London.

Nick joined the White bear Group in 2016 to help establish Syndicate 5886 at Lloyd’s of which he is now Active Underwriter. Prior to this Nick worked for over 35 years in both the Lloyds and Company markets, focusing on primarily US Treaty reinsurance. Before joining White Bear Group in 2016, Nick was the US Treaty Underwriter for Cathedral Syndicate from 2002. Prior to that he was head of the Treaty reinsurance team at SVB Syndicates. He started his career as an underwriting assistant in 1985 at the Excess Ins Co.
